Superfast broadband (30 Mbps+) coverage at YO17 6TY stands at 50%. That is below the UK average of 93%.

Looking at the full speed profile for YO17 6TY gives a better picture of what to expect. 50% of connections fall in the 10 to 30 Mbps range. 50% of connections fall in the 30 to 300 Mbps range. No premises here are stuck below 5 Mbps. Every property meets the basic threshold for video calls.

What do the broadband speeds at YO17 6TY mean in practice?

Fixed Wireless Access (FWA) is available to 66.7% of premises at YO17 6TY. FWA uses a fixed antenna to deliver broadband without a phone line or fibre cable. FWA coverage is strong here. Providers like Three and EE offer home broadband over their mobile networks.

0% of premises at YO17 6TY fall below the Universal Service Obligation of 10 Mbps. Every property here meets the minimum standard. That is not the case everywhere. Next-generation access (NGA) reaches 100% of the area. NGA typically means speeds of 24 Mbps or above.

4G outdoor coverage at YO17 6TY reaches 95%. Indoor 4G drops to 85%. Some signal loss indoors is normal. Most calls and data should still work inside. Coverage data covers EE, O2, Three, Vodafone. Check each operator individually, as coverage varies by network. Strong 4G coverage combined with limited fixed broadband means 4G home broadband could be a practical alternative here.
